Teo and Omnitel become Telia in Lithuania
Feb 1, 2017 – Teo, Omnitel and Baltic Data Center have become one company – Telia Lietuva. The integrated telecommunications company in Lithuania will provide telecommunications, IT and TV services as a one-stop shop.

Teo adds 6,733 TV subscribers in 3Q 2015
Oct 20, 2015 – Lithuanian IT and telecommunications company, Teo, has released results for the third quarter of this year. Over the past 12 months, the number of Teo smart television (IPTV) users increased by 23.1 per cent.
